>>B<< ADJUSTING SCREW INSTALLATION

When installing provisionally the screw to rocker arm, project it
slightly 3mm (0.12 in) from the same face level of the rocker
arm end.

>>C<< ROCKER SHAFT SPRING/ROCKER ARMS
AND ROCKER ARM SHAFT INSTALLATION

1. In accordance with the tags made during removal, install the

rocker arm, and other parts to the rocker arm shaft.

2. Install the rocker arm shaft with oil hole to the lower (cylinder

head) side.

3. Temporarily install the rocker arm, rocker arm shaft

assembly and intake.

4. Temporarily install the rocker arm, rocker arm shaft

assembly and exhaust.

5. Confirm the each rocker arm and rocker arm shaft assembly

are in position and then tighten to the specified torque.

Tightening torque:

M6: 13

± 1 Nm (115 ± 8 in-lb)

M8: 31

± 3 Nm (23 ± 3 ft-lb)

>>D<< CAMSHAFT OIL SEAL INSTALLATION

1. Apply engine oil to the lip area of the oil seal and the front

end outside diameter of camshaft.

2. Using special tool MD998713, install the camshaft oil seal.

CAMSHAFT

Measure the cam height. If it is below the limit, replace the
camshaft.

STANDARD
VALUE

MINIMUM
LIMIT

A: Intake low speed
cam A

33.84 mm
(1.332 in)

33.34 mm
(1.313 in)

B: Intake low speed
cam B

37.35 mm
(1.471 in)

36.85 mm
(1.451 in)

C: Intake high speed
cam

37.21 mm
(1.465 in)

36.71 mm
(1.445 in)

D: Exhaust cam

37.86 mm
(1.491 in)

37.36 mm
(1.471 in)

REMOVAL SERVICE POINTS

.

<<A>> CYLINDER HEAD BOLTS REMOVAL

Using special tool MB991654, loosen the cylinder head bolts.
Loosen each bolt evenly, little by little, in two or three steps.

.

<<B>> RETAINER LOCK REMOVAL

1. Set special tool MD998735 as illustrated to compress the

valve spring. Remove the retainer lock.

2. Relieve the spring tension and remove the valve, retainer,

spring, etc. Tag the removed valves, springs, and other
parts, to indicate their cylinder number and location for
reassembly.

INSTALLATION SERVICE POINTS

.

>>A<< VALVE STEM SEAL INSTALLATION

CAUTION

The special tool must be used to install the valve stem
seal. Improper installation could result in oil leaking past
the valve guide.
1. Install the valve spring seat.
2. Using special tool MB991999, install a new valve stem seal.
